BERKELEY, Calif. -- University of California, Berkeley, Chancellor Carol Christ signed a memorandum of understanding last week committing the Berkeley campus to 100 percent clean, renewable energy by 2050. The University of California system already made a pledge to purchase only clean electricity by 2025, but this commitment goes further

BERKELEY, CA — The United States can deliver 90 percent clean, carbon-free electricity nationwide by 2035, dependably, at no extra cost to consumer bills and without the need for new fossil fuel plants, according to a study released today from the Center for Environmental Public Policy at the University of California, Berkeley. The study also

The University of California, Berkeley (UC Berkeley) team will jointly develop an integrated process to produce butanol directly from air-captured carbon dioxide (CO2). Butanol has a higher energy density than ethanol and is a precursor to jet fuel. UC Berkeley''s system takes three main inputs: ambient air, water, and a sustainable energy source, and produces
